Warrior angels, vampire hunters, and angels gone bad heat up this altogether sizzling paranormal alternate universe, from the bestselling author Nalini Singh.

Angels' Judgement is the compelling story of passion, love and danger in the Guild Hunter world. Sara and Deacon are Guild Hunters, their life's work is catching and capturing - or killing - rogue angels. It's dangerous work and sometimes life or death decisions must be made in a moment. And when a judgement has to be made, should love be allowed to get in the way . . . ?

I've been writing as long as I can remember and all of my stories always held a thread of romance (even when I was writing about a prince who could shoot lasers out of his eyes). I love creating unique characters, love giving them happy endings and I even love the voices in my head. There's no other job I would rather be doing. In September 2002, when I got the call that Silhouette Desire wanted to buy my first book, Desert Warrior, it was a dream come true. I hope to continue living the dream until I keel over of old age on my keyboard.


I was born in Fiji and raised in New Zealand. I also spent three years living and working in Japan, during which time I took the chance to travel around Asia. I’m back in New Zealand now, but I’m always plotting new trips. If you’d like to see some of my travel snapshots, have a look at the Travel Diary page (updated every month).

So far, I've worked as a lawyer, a librarian, a candy factory general hand, a bank temp and an English teacher and not necessarily in that order. Some might call that inconsistency but I call it grist for the writer's mill.

I read this story as part of the Angels' Flight anthology which contains 4 Guild Hunter novellas.

I have liked Elena's best friend Sara from the moment we first met her in Angel's Blood. As the guild director she has always gone out on a limb for her people and she is particularly protective of Elena even when that does mean facing off against a pissed off archangel. Sara and weapon expert Deacon are such a cute couple and I've always enjoyed seeing Elena spend time with them but it was fantastic to actually discover how they met each other and became a couple.

This story has a nice amount of action as Sara and Deacon work together to track down a rogue hunter who has started murdering vampires. Sara is also facing trials thrown at her by the archangels because she is about to become the new guild director and the odds are not in her favour. The chemistry between Deacon and Sara is fantastic, they have trouble keeping their hands off each other but their worlds are far apart and they both have reservations about how a relationship between them would work. Sara worries that Deacon wouldn't want to have her as his boss when she becomes director and Deacon prefers a quiet life away from the spotlight which is something the director will never be able to have. I just love this couple and it was great to have a story which focuses on them, I hope we get to see more slices of their life together further down the line.

ANGELS' JUDGMENT: This is a prequel novella to the Guild Hunter series. This novella introduces Sara who is the leading candidate to be the new Guild Director. She meets Deacon who is a slayer tasked with tracking down rogue hunters. Deacon has arrived to be a bodyguard for Sara because the Angels have a habit of testing potential directors in deadly ways. The two are in search of a rogue and end up in a romantic relationship that has no future because Sara's very public new job does not mesh with Deacon's very private responsiblity. I liked this story and did not feel that I needed to know any other information other than what was introduced in this story. It interested me in reading more about the series. Rating: 4 stars.
